Cabin window replacement services involve removing old or damaged windows and installing new, high-quality units that improve the property's appearance, energy efficiency, and security. This process typically includes measuring existing window openings, selecting suitable window styles and materials, and carefully installing the new units to ensure proper fit and function. Skilled service providers pay close attention to details like weatherproofing and insulation, helping homeowners achieve a more comfortable and visually appealing living space.
Replacing cabin windows can address a variety of common problems. Over time, windows may become cracked, fogged, or warped, which can lead to drafts and increased energy costs. In some cases, old windows may no longer open or close properly, posing safety concerns. Upgrading to newer, more durable windows can also help reduce outside noise and improve overall home security. The overview below groups typical Cabin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wallingford, CT.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typically, fixing or replacing a single cabin window can c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, especially for standard-sized windows with basic frames. Costs may vary based on window size and material specifics.
Full Window Replacement - Replacing an entire cabin window usually ranges from $600 to $1,200 for standard models. Larger or more custom windows can push costs higher, but most projects in this category stay within this middle range.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Larger, more complex window replacements or custom installations can reach $1,500 to $3,000 or more. These projects are less common and typically involve specialized materials or unique design features.
Multiple Window Installations - Installing several windows at once often results in a bulk rate, with total costs generally between $2,000 and $5,000. Many local pros offer discounted rates for multiple-window projects, though prices can vary based on quantity and complexity.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of window styles are available for cabin window replacement? Local contractors typically offer a variety of styles such as double-hung, casement, sliding, and picture windows to suit different cabin designs and preferences.
Can cabin window replacement improve energy efficiency? Yes, many service providers install energy-efficient windows that help reduce heat transfer and enhance insulation in cabins.
What materials are commonly used for cabin window frames? Common options include wood, vinyl, and aluminum, each providing different benefits in durability and appearance.
Is it necessary to obtain permits for replacing cabin windows? Permit requirements vary by location; local contractors can advise on whether permits are needed for window replacement projects in Wallingford, CT.
What should be considered when choosing new windows for a cabin? Factors such as climate, cabin style, and maintenance preferences are important, and local service providers can help determine the best options.
